    Quote Originally Posted by FleaFlicker View Post
    Following this thread. This storm is fascinating to watch. When do you think it will make that turn? Are you a believer of the Hebert Box?
    It is already slowing down as it is finding the weak spot in the high pressure. It should really start moving north in the next 48 hours or so. The Hebert Box, while present, is only a tool in predicting the landfall possibility. Hebert even said himself that it is not a tried and true indicator that a storm will hit Florida. Basically the basis for the boxes is that the storms will miss Cuba on its way to landfall. The portion of Cuba that Matthew will have to travel through is pretty mountainous, it is also the largest land mass of Cuba it will have to go through. So Cuba and Jamaica together will strongly decrease the strength of Matthew.

    Quote Originally Posted by TheRef View Post
    You may want to watch out for Hurricane Matthew that's spinning south of Hispanola. He is a Category 3 Hurricane right now, and is expected to strengthen further before making landfall in Jamaica. Matthew is getting the benefit of untouched waters to build and intensify. Current tracks have Matthew missing the Gulf of Mexico, due to a cutoff Low Pressure center over the middle of the country. Now the model guidance does not have landfall coming to Florida currently, but this could change within the next 3-4 days depending on the track Matthew takes through Jamaica and Cuba. Needless to say, the whole Eastern seaboard needs to be watching this system closely.
